upright

Definition

  • noun: a board or pole placed in a vertical position to support something
  • noun: the state of being upright
  • adjective: positioned to be straight up
  • adjective: erect in carriage or posture

Examples

  • She 'sat bolt upright' [=she sat up straight] in bed when I entered the room.

  • There wasn't enough room to stand 'upright', so we had to bend over.

  • The 'uprights' of the structure were embedded in concrete.
